Material takeoffs are essentially lists of all the materials needed for a project. They include quantities, specifications, and sometimes even costs. When done correctly, they provide a clear roadmap for procurement and help avoid costly mistakes.


Understanding Material Takeoffs


Before diving into tailored material takeoffs, it is essential to understand what they are and why they matter. A material takeoff is a detailed list of materials required for a construction project. This list is derived from project plans and specifications.


Why Are Material Takeoffs Important?


  • Cost Estimation: Accurate takeoffs help in estimating project costs. Knowing the exact quantities of materials needed allows for better budgeting.


  • Time Management: With a clear list of materials, project managers can schedule deliveries and avoid delays.


  • Waste Reduction: Tailored takeoffs help minimize waste by ensuring only the necessary materials are ordered.


  • Improved Communication: A well-prepared takeoff serves as a communication tool among team members, suppliers, and clients.

Steps to Create Tailored Material Takeoffs


Creating a tailored material takeoff involves several steps. Here’s a simple guide to help you get started:


Step 1: Review Project Plans


Begin by reviewing the project plans and specifications. This will give you a clear understanding of what materials are needed.


Step 2: Break Down the Project


Divide the project into smaller sections. This makes it easier to identify specific materials required for each part of the project.


Step 3: List Materials


Create a detailed list of materials needed for each section. Include quantities, specifications, and any other relevant information.


Step 4: Consult with Team Members


Engage with your team members to ensure nothing is overlooked. They may have insights or suggestions that can improve the takeoff.


Step 5: Update Regularly


As the project progresses, update the takeoff as needed. This ensures that it remains accurate and relevant throughout the project lifecycle.


Tools for Tailored Material Takeoffs


There are several tools available that can help streamline the process of creating tailored material takeoffs. Here are a few popular options:


1. Software Solutions


Many software programs are designed specifically for material takeoffs. These tools can automate calculations and help generate accurate lists quickly.


2. Spreadsheets


For smaller projects, a simple spreadsheet can be effective. You can create columns for material types, quantities, and costs.


3. Mobile Apps


Mobile apps allow for on-the-go access to material takeoffs. This can be particularly useful for field teams who need to reference materials while on-site.

Common Mistakes to Avoid


While creating tailored material takeoffs, it is essential to avoid common pitfalls. Here are a few mistakes to watch out for:


1. Overlooking Details


Small details can make a big difference. Ensure that every material is accounted for, including fasteners and finishes.


2. Ignoring Changes


Design changes are common in construction. Failing to update the takeoff can lead to significant issues down the line.


3. Lack of Communication


Communication is key. Ensure that all team members are on the same page regarding the materials needed.


4. Not Using Technology


In today’s digital age, there are many tools available to assist with material takeoffs. Not utilizing these can lead to inefficiencies.
